Kriti Sanon remembers Sushant Singh Rajput on 4 years of Raabta

CE Features

Dinesh Vijan’s directorial debut, Raabta, was released on this day in 2017. 

On the film’s 4th anniversary, actor Kriti Sanon has remembered her late co-star Sushant Singh Rajput. Kriti and Sushant had portrayed star-crossed lovers in the reincarnation drama. The film also starred Rajkummar Rao, Jim Sarbh and Varun Sharma. 

Kriti shared a BTS video with Sushant from the film's shoot. 

She wrote: "I believe in connection, I believe that we are meant to meet the people we do… My Raabta with Sushant, Dinoo and MaddockFilms was just meant to be... Films come and go... But every single film has so so many memories behind it... The connections we make and the moments we live with each other stay within us... Some more than others," Kriti wrote alongside the video on Instagram.

"Raabta was one of my best and most memorable experiences and it will ALWAYS remain extremely close to my heart… Little did I know that it would be our first and last..." Kriti added.

Sushant died by suicide on June 14 in Mumbai last year.
